Talk: Building UIs for Everyone: Accessibility as a Frontend Responsibility
Speaker: Kushal Kumar Nerella
Abstract:
Kushal will share some of the accessibility work he's been doing as part of Amazon’s homepage team. Over the past year, he's tackled issues like broken carousels, missing focus indicators, and screen reader confusion — all in a high-traffic environment where things can’t just “sort of” work. He'll talk about what he's learned building for accessibility at scale, the tools and techniques he relied on, and why this stuff really matters for every frontend engineer. Whether you’re shipping enterprise UI or just want to make your components more inclusive, this talk will give you practical ideas you can take back to your own codebase.
